LAD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

313 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Lithia Motors (LAD)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$3.39B — up 9.3% from $3.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 59 funds opened new LAD posit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 37 holders — while 96 added to existing stakes and 118 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lord, Abbett & Co, opening a new position worth an estimated $32.1M. The largest seller was Park West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$26.2M sold.
